Where You’ll Work

Founded in 1951, Dignity Health - Mark Twain Medical Center is a 25-bed, acute care, nonprofit hospital located in San Andreas, California. Serving over 90,000 patients annually, the hospital offers a full complement of services including cancer care, emergency care, and orthopedics. Mark Twain Medical Center also includes four Family Medical Clinics offering exams, immunizations, and care for minor injuries. Additionally, Mark Twain Medical Center has been recognized as an LGBTQ+ Healthcare Equality High Performer by the Human Rights Campaign Foundation.It is the only medical facility in Calavaras County.

Job Summary and Responsibilities

As a Patient Registration Representative, you will ensure a positive patient experience during registration, employing excellent customer service.Every day you will identify patients, collect accurate demographics, verify insurance, determine/collect financial liability, and explain hospital policies and patient rights to families.To be successful, you will demonstrate exceptional customer service, meticulous attention to detail in data/insurance, and strong communication, crucial for patient satisfaction and reimbursement.

  • Maintains up-to-date knowledge of specific registration requirements for all areas, including but not limited to: Main Admitting, OP Registration, ED Registration, Maternity, and Rehabilitation units
  • Ensures complete, accurate and timely entry of demographic information into the ADT system at the time of registration.
  • Properly identifies the patient to ensure medical record numbers are not duplicated.
  • Responsible for reviewing assigned accounts to ensure accuracy and required documentation is obtained and complete.
  • Meet CMS billing requirements for the completion of the MSP, issuance of the Important Message from Medicare, issuance of the Observation Notice, and other requirements, as applicable and documenting completion within the hospital's information system for regulatory compliance and audit purposes
  • Collects and enters required data into the ADT system with emphasis on accuracy of demographic and financial information in order to ensure appropriate reimbursement.
